Collector Nazim Saleem calls for further improvement in Hyderabad Customs

byAslam Anjum Qureshi
22/03/2015
in Latest News, National
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

HYDERABAD: Enforcement-South Chief Collector Nazim Saleem visited the Model Customs Collectorate Hyderabad and expressed complete satisfaction over the performance of the Anti-Smuggling Organisation in the region.

Talking to officials at the collectorate, the chief collector said that the department should accelerate its activities and further improve its performance in order to curb smuggling of contraband items, especially Iranian high-speed diesel and foreign origin non-customs paid vehicles.
